SM Omron Plugin

A comprehensive Flutter plugin for integrating Omron healthcare devices on Android. This plugin supports a wide range of devices including Blood Pressure monitors, Weight Scales, Pulse Oximeters, and Activity Trackers via BLE, as well as Temperature measurement via audio frequency.

Features

  • Unified API: Access data from various device types through a single, consistent interface.
  • Normalized Data: All results are returned as VitalResult objects, making it easy to handle diverse health data.
  • Explicit Pairing: Robust pairing workflow that ensures devices are bonded correctly with the Android system.
  • Native UI: Custom-built Android parsers and handlers for reliable data transfer.
  • Audio Support: Unique support for Omron microphone-based temperature devices (e.g., MC-280B-E).
  • Asset Integration: Built-in support for device thumbnails.

Supported Device Categories

  • Blood Pressure (BLE) - e.g., BP7450, HEM-9200T
  • Weight Scale / Body Composition (BLE) - e.g., BCM-500, HBF-222T
  • Pulse Oximeter (BLE) - e.g., P300
  • Activity Tracker (BLE) - e.g., HJA-405T
  • Temperature (Audio) - e.g., MC-280B-E
  • Wheeze Detector (BLE) - e.g., HWZ-1000T

Installation

Add the following to your pubspec.yaml:

dependencies:
  sm_omron:
    git: https://github.com/SmartMindSYSCoder/sm_omron.git

Getting Started

1. Import

You now only need to import one file to access all models, enums, and widgets:

import 'package:sm_omron/sm_omron.dart';

2. Android Setup

Ensure your android/app/build.gradle defines a minimum SDK version of at least 24 (26+ recommended for best BLE performance).

defaultConfig {
    minSdkVersion 24
    ...
}

2. Permissions

Add the necessary permissions to your AndroidManifest.xml:

<!-- BLE Permissions -->
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_ADMIN"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.ACCESS_FINE_LOCATION" /> <!-- Required for BLE on older Android -->
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_SCAN"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_CONNECT" />

<!-- Audio Permission (For Temperature Devices) -->
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.RECORD_AUDIO" />

Usage

Initialization

import 'package:sm_omron/sm_omron.dart';

final _smOmron = SMOmron();

// Required: Initialize plugin storage
await _smOmron.initialize();

1. Permissions Check

Before starting, request the required permissions:

// For BLE Devices
await _smOmron.checkBluetoothPermissions();

// For Audio/Temperature Devices
await _smOmron.checkMicrophonePermissions();

2. Discover & Pair Device

Use the built-in OmronDeviceSelectorDialog to let users choose a compatible device, then scan and pair it.

// 1. Show Device Selector
final deviceModel = await OmronDeviceSelectorDialog.show(
  context,
  title: "Select Your Device",
  categoryFilter: DeviceCategory.bloodPressure, // Optional filter
);

if (deviceModel != null) {
  ScannedDevice? scannedDevice;

  // 2. Check Device Type (Audio vs BLE)
  if (deviceModel.isRecordingWave) {
    // For Audio/Temperature devices (e.g. MC-280B-E), create directly
    scannedDevice = _smOmron.addRecordingWaveDevice(deviceModel);
  } else {
    // For BLE devices, scan specifically for the selected model
    // Ensure the device has a valid identifier mapped
    if (deviceModel.deviceIdentifier != null) {
      scannedDevice = await _smOmron.scanBleDevice(deviceIdentifier: deviceModel.deviceIdentifier!);
    }
  }
  
  if (scannedDevice != null) {
     // 3. Explicitly pair (Bond) if needed (for BLE)
     // Audio devices skip this or return true immediately
     bool paired = await _smOmron.pairBleDevice(device: scannedDevice);
     
     if (paired) {
       // 4. Save device for future use
       await _smOmron.saveDevice(scannedDevice);
     }
  }
}

3. Transfer Data (BLE)

Once a device is paired and saved, you can transfer data from it.

try {
  List<VitalResult> results = await _smOmron.transferFromBleDevice(
    device: mySavedDevice,
    options: TransferOptions(
      readHistoricalData: true, // Set to true to read all past data
    ),
    // personalInfo is required for Body Composition devices (Weight scales)
    personalInfo: PersonalInfo(
        heightCm: 175, 
        weightKg: 70, 
        dateOfBirth: DateTime(1990, 1, 1), 
        gender: Gender.male
    ),
  );

  for (var result in results) {
     print("Sys: ${result.systolic}, Dia: ${result.diastolic}");
  }
} catch (e) {
  print("Transfer failed: $e");
}

4. Record Temperature (Audio)

For microphone-based devices like the MC-280B-E:

try {
  VitalResult? tempResult = await _smOmron.recordTemperature();
  
  if (tempResult != null) {
    print("Temp: ${tempResult.temperature} ${tempResult.temperatureUnit}");
  }
} catch (e) {
  print("Recording failed: $e");
}

5. Unpairing

To remove a device and unbond it from the Android system:

await _smOmron.removeDevice(mySavedDevice);

Data Models

VitalResult

The VitalResult class unifies all measurements. Check result.type to know which fields are populated.

  • Blood Pressure: systolic, diastolic, pulse, irregularHeartbeat
  • Weight: weight, bodyFat, skeletalMuscle, bmi
  • Activity: steps, calories, distance
  • Pulse Ox: spo2Level, pulseRate
  • Temperature: temperature

Troubleshooting

  • System Pairing Dialog Not Creating: The plugin uses a native fix to force the pairing dialog. If it still doesn't appear, ensure the device is in "Pairing Mode" (usually hold the Bluetooth button for 3-5 seconds until it flashes 'P').
  • "MissingPluginException": Ensure you have rebuilt the app (flutter run) after adding the plugin packages.
  • Location Permission: On Android 11 and below, ACCESS_FINE_LOCATION is required for BLE scanning to work. Ensure this is granted.
